Detailed Description:
Celebrate the art of traditional Odia weaving with this striking Sambalpuri Ikat cotton kurti, a perfect harmony of cultural richness and everyday wearability. Crafted by skilled artisans, this piece brings out the intricate beauty of Odisha’s famed handloom heritage.
Key Features:
Primary Color Scheme:
A bold and festive combination of rich red, deep green, and ivory white, accented with traditional Ikat check patterns.
Front Pattern:
The central panel features square-shaped checkered motifs in red and white, framed by stylized elephant and fish designs in soft grey—classic Sambalpuri symbols representing strength and prosperity.
Neckline:
The neckline is crafted in a subtle V-shape with a green piping finish, adding definition and a neat frame to the design.
Sleeves:
The solid red 3/4th sleeves offer a striking contrast to the patterned body. The cuffs are embellished with a decorative triangular green border, echoing tribal geometry.
Side Panels:
The sides of the kurti include vertically aligned Ikat patterns in darker tones, subtly narrowing the silhouette and giving a flattering shape.
Fabric & Comfort:
Made from handwoven Sambalpuri cotton, the fabric is known for its breathable, durable, and soft texture—ideal for both daily wear and casual gatherings.
